MSComm1.CommPort = i1
MSComm1.PortOpen = True
MSComm1.InputMode = comInputModeBinary
MSComm1.InBufferCount = 0
MSComm1.InputLen = 0
MSComm1.Settings = "9600,N,8,1"
MSComm1.RThreshold = 1
MSComm1.OutBufferCount = 0
无论您是否了解MODBUS通讯协议,拥有了本源码,都可以快速编制VB6.0的MODBUS RTU方式通讯程序,当然,您也可以利用本源码学习MODBUS通讯协议此源码为本店主编制。
店主在上位机与PLC、仪表等控制器通讯方面有十多年的实践经历,编程经验丰富,通讯处理思路独特,编制的通讯程序稳定,快速!
我的源码都是敬派清开放的,您完全可以看到发送与接收的信息,完全可以利用源码学会MODBUS通讯协议!
购买本程序,店主提供一个月的技术帮助(从您购买之日算起),帮助您理解MODBUS通讯协议!
发货方式:发到您的QQ信箱或是直接用阿里旺旺传送!
学会本源码,您可以编制MODBUS通讯协议的羡余:
01 、02 、03 、04 、05 、06、0F、10 这八种功能码的MODBUS通讯协议VB6.0程序亮前。
RS485通讯程序的孝顷编程和RS232类似,对于你采用的是半双工通讯,那老族么就是接收巧含陆时不能发送,按照你的图纸,你发送的U4的2,3管脚接在什么地方了?这个脚是控制接收还是发送的管脚。
在这里你要规定通讯协议,RS485只是一个物理层协议。通讯程序和RS232通讯程序基本相同,只是要对U4的2,3连接的口进行置高为发送,低为接收。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)